Exploring Lima, Arequipa & Cusco

Discover the cultural and natural highlights of Peru on this immersive 11-day journey through Lima, Arequipa, Colca Canyon, Cusco, the Sacred Valley, and Machu Picchu, curated by Indigo Expedition. This carefully designed itinerary blends colonial heritage, Andean landscapes, ancient Inca sites, and unforgettable wildlife encounters.

Begin in Lima with a traditional city tour of the historic center, Huaca Pucllana, and the San Francisco Monastery and Catacombs. Fly to Arequipa, the “White City,” to explore panoramic viewpoints and the iconic Santa Catalina Monastery. Continue into the spectacular Colca Canyon, passing through the Vicuñas National Reserve and witnessing the majestic flight of Andean condors at Cruz del Cóndor.

Travel onward to Cusco, the former capital of the Inca Empire, for a guided city tour and visits to Sacsayhuamán, Qenqo, Puka Pukara, and Tambomachay. Explore the Sacred Valley, visit Pisac and Ollantaytambo, and enjoy a scenic train journey to Aguas Calientes.

The highlight of the journey is a guided visit to Machu Picchu, one of the New Seven Wonders of the World, accompanied by a private local guide. Itinerary

Arrival in Lima, reception at the airport, and private transfer to your hotel. The remainder of the day is free to relax or explore the surroundings at your own pace.

After breakfast, enjoy a guided city tour of Lima. Visit the Huaca Pucllana Pyramid, explore the historic center including Plaza Mayor and colonial monuments, and tour the San Francisco Monastery and Catacombs. Continue through San Isidro, Miraflores, and Larcomar.

Transfer to Lima airport for your flight to Arequipa (not included). Upon arrival, transfer to your hotel. In the afternoon, enjoy a guided city tour visiting Carmen Alto viewpoint, Yanahuara Square, Plaza de Armas, the Church of the Society of Jesus, and the Monastery of Santa Catalina.

Early departure to the Colca Valley. Stop at Salinas y Aguada Blanca National Reserve to see vicuñas, llamas, and alpacas. Continue to Tocra Pampa wetlands and Patapampa viewpoint. Arrive in Chivay for lunch. Afternoon free to relax or enjoy thermal baths. Optional dinner show in the evening.

Early morning visit to Cruz del Cóndor viewpoint to observe condors in flight. Visit Antawilke terraces and the village of Maca. Lunch in Chivay before returning to Arequipa.
